What is AZ Home Complaint Form

The Arizona Manufactured Home Complaint Form is a complaint document used by purchasers of manufactured or mobile homes to report issues to the Office of Manufactured Housing.

What is the Arizona Manufactured Home Complaint Form?

The Arizona Manufactured Home Complaint Form serves as a crucial tool for reporting issues related to manufactured or mobile homes. Its primary purpose is to facilitate the documentation of both cosmetic and non-cosmetic complaints, ensuring that concerns are adequately voiced to the relevant authorities.
This form is specifically designed for purchasers of manufactured homes who have encountered problems that they wish to report. Complainants can submit this form directly to the Office of Manufactured Housing, which oversees the complaints process and resolution.

Required Documents and Supporting Materials

To effectively process your complaint, certain documents must accompany the Arizona Manufactured Home Complaint Form. Appropriate documentation enhances the credibility of your claim and facilitates quicker resolution.
  • Purchase agreements that detail the transaction.
  • Walk-through documents highlighting any pre-existing conditions.
  • Maps or layouts for context regarding the property.
Including these materials strengthens your complaint submission and helps avoid delays.
